Heavy rainfall is not the only cause of flooding. Internal issues like burst pipes as well as overflows can lead to emergency flooding. Sadly, this will certainly likewise cause damages to your residential property. Failing to address the issue will certainly escalate the damage as well as raise the chances of mold growth. Keep reviewing to find out what you can when handling emergency flooding.

1. Turn Off Key Water Valve

Pipes can rupture due to cold temps, high pressure, obstruction, water heating system concerns, as well as various other variables. No issue the cause, you should act swiftly to make certain permeable residence products, devices, and also furnishings do not absorb the water, resulting in damages.

2. Shut Off the Breaker

Water is a conductor, as well as if it reaches your electrical outlets, it can trigger injuries or fatalities. Keep the power off till excess water is gone.

3. Relocate Necessary Damp Times

When it involves conserving your furnishings and home appliances, time is essential. For this reason, you need to relocate whatever whet personal belongings you can from the damaged area to a completely dry place. This hinders additional damages since the longer they take in water, the a lot more extensive the trouble.

4. Record the Degree of Damage

Take note of all the damage brought upon by the ruptured pipeline. With documents, you can also get a clear photo of the level of the damage.

5. Eliminate Water ASAP

You need to eliminate excess water immediately. Must there be a huge amount of standing water, you might require a water pump for removal. You can lease this tools if you don't possess one. If it's late in the evening, the convention bucket method also works. Usage a number of jugs and also manual work to take it out. When very little water is left, you can soak up the rest with old t shirts or towels. You might likewise need to eliminate broken products like rugs and rugs.

6. Dry the Area

You can also set up electrical fans and also placed them in the toughest setting. A dehumidifier likewise works in taking out wetness to protect against mold and also mold and mildews.

7. Collaborate with Experts

When you endure comprehensive water damage because of emergency flooding from a burst pipe, you can collaborate with a repair professional to restore as well as renovate your home. Most of all, do not forget to call a trustworthy plumber to deal with the ruptured pipeline as well as examine the remainder of your piping system. Making It Through the Imperfect Tornado: Tips for Emergency Preparations



If you stay in a storm-prone area, you should be utilized now on what to do, where to go and what to have to be planned for negative weather. If you're not made use of to getting pummeled by high winds and also difficult rainfall, you probably don't have an suggestion just how ideal to deal with a tornado circumstance.

For starters, tornados do not just come without a caution. Weather stations check the ambience day in and day out. If a tornado is feasible, they will provide two kinds of warnings:

Storm watch-- is released when there is a feasible tornado in your location. You probably will be experiencing a dark, gloomy sky, an abnormally windy day and some rain. The storm may or may not come, but this is the time to maintain tuned to your regional radio for information and updates.

Storm warning-- is released when a storm is headed toward your location. Attempt to stay inside as much as possible. Or if citizens are recommended to leave to a more secure area, go as early as you can. Do not wait till the eleventh hour to leave your home. Already, the streets could be flooded as well as web traffic is bad. You do not intend to be captured in your auto in bad climate.

Snowstorm-- typically happens in winter season and indicates heavy snow, solid winds and also wind chill. When a caution is provided, prevent traveling as much as possible and also stay indoors. There is no use subjecting on your own outdoors where you could get caught in website traffic or in locations where you will be difficult to reach or worse, find.

For all our technology, no one can stop a storm from coming. The only means to survive it is to be prepared to face the emergency situation. Points don't always spoil throughout storms, however weather is unpredictable and also anything can occur. To help you plan for a storm emergency, below are a couple of tips:

Dress up.
Use sufficient clothes to keep yourself cozy. Heat may not be offered in your home so obtain added layers and coverings to preserve your body temperature level sufficiently. Have your mittens, handwear covers, hats, socks and also boots all set.

Have food prepared.
Emergency provisions are a have to throughout storm emergency situations. If the storm gets as well negative and the streets are swamped, you will certainly have a difficulty going out to the grocery shops.

Keep bottles of water helpful. Tidy water might be tough ahead by throughout actually bad problems and also the most awful point you can do is suffer from dehydration because you were not prepared. Maintain a supply of at the very least one gallon for every single individual each day that will last for 3 to 4 days.

Load the bathtub.
You'll need more water for cleaning as well as flushing the commodes. When the power is out, your water pump won't run, so best fill your tub, water containers as well as pails with water. If you have small children in your house, take safety measures by covering deep containers and also keeping youngsters away from the shower room unless necessary.

Emergency package
Have a clinical or first set all set and make certain it's freshly-stocked. It should consist of anti-bacterials, gauzes, cotton rounds, Q-tips, medicated plasters and required medications. It's additionally a good concept to have one more set in your cars and truck.

If anybody in your family members is under unique medication, make certain you have sufficient materials to last up until after the storm is over and drug stores are open.

Lights off
Expect power interruptions during storm emergency situations. You won't have any electrical power, so stock on candle lights, flashlights and emergency lights. Have extra fresh batteries and suits in case you run out.

If you can not turn on the TV, have a battery-powered radio listened to a station that covers your location. Media will certainly keep track of the storm as well as will certainly keep you updated.

You could require warm water throughout the duration when power is not yet offered, so maintain a little container of gas around just in case. Your outdoor gas grill will do well.

Get an alternating sanctuary.
If you assume your residence will experience significantly, it's a excellent idea to consider an alternate shelter. It could be an discharge center or one more home or building that is more secure. See to it you have sufficient gas in your container in case you require to leave your house and also action someplace. Maintain to a greater ground where you have much better possibilities of being risk-free as well as dry.
